Abstract

Abstract This paper offers a shock wave solution to modified Zakharov–Kuznetsov (MZK) Burgers equation in inhomogeneous dusty plasmas with external magnetic field. For this purpose, the fluid equations are reduced to an MZK Burgers equation containing variable coefficients by reductive perturbation method. With the aid of travelling-wave transformation technique, we obtain the analytical oscillatory shock wave solution and monotonic shock wave solution for MZK Burgers equation. The effects of inhomogeneity, external magnetic field, dust charge variation on characteristics of two types of shock waves are examined in detail.
